The numbers below refer to the step numbers on the diagnostic table.
- 3: This step tests the ignition switch for a short circuit between the 12-volt reference supply circuit and the ignition 3 circuit in the OFF position.
- 4: This step tests the wiring of the ignition 3 circuit for a short to ground or voltage.
- 5: This step tests the ignition switch for a closed circuit between the ignition switch 12-volt reference supply circuit and the ignition 3 circuit in the Run and Crank switch positions. Care must be taken as the engine may crank during this test.
